With allusion to romans iii. 8 (AV) And not‥Let us do evil, that good may come.
We must not doo euil, that good may come of it: yet the lawes in permitting certain reasonable gain to be received for the loane of money lent‥haue not doone much amisse.
[1583 P. Stubbes Anatomie of Abuses K5]
If I knew any thing whereby to justify the present proceeding, I should not conceal it; but we must not do evil that good may come of it.
[1689 G. Bulkeley Letter in Coll. Connecticut Hist. Society (1860) I. 59]
Walsingham's agents‥did evil that good might come, thinking Mary's death alone would ensure them from Pope and Spaniard.
[1882 C. M. Yonge Unknown to History II. ix.]
What‥were the ethics? A promise made to a silly child, was it binding? You mustn't do evil that good may come of it‥but the boy was only fourteen and practically half-witted, and Lisa was an absurd little Quixote.
[1950 J. Cannan Murder Included 127]
